四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)_第1页
四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)_第2页
四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)_第3页
四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)_第4页
四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)科目授课时间节次--年—月—日(星期——)第—节指导教师授课班级、授课课时授课题目(包括教材及章节名称)四、搭建角色脚本教学设计-2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)教材分析2025-2026学年小学信息技术粤教版B版五年级上册-粤教版(B版)中的“搭建角色脚本”章节,通过结合实际操作和创意思维,让学生了解脚本在信息技术中的应用,培养学生的编程思维和创新能力。本章节内容紧密联系课本,注重实践操作,旨在提高学生信息技术素养。核心素养目标培养学生信息意识,提高问题解决能力,通过搭建角色脚本,让学生体验编程乐趣,激发创新思维。增强学生团队合作意识,培养动手实践能力,学会运用信息技术解决实际问题。教学难点与重点1.教学重点

-理解脚本的基本概念:通过实例讲解脚本的组成,如动作、事件和逻辑判断,使学生掌握脚本的基本结构和功能。

-掌握角色动作编程:以角色移动为例,让学生学会如何通过编写脚本控制角色的行为,如前进、后退、转向等。

2.教学难点

-复杂逻辑判断的应用:在脚本编写中,学生可能会遇到需要根据不同条件执行不同动作的情况,如判断角色是否到达某个位置。

-脚本调试与优化:学生在编写脚本时,可能会遇到脚本运行错误,需要通过调试找出问题所在并进行优化,这是学生需要克服的难点。

-脚本的可读性与维护:强调编写清晰、易读的脚本的重要性,以及如何通过良好的命名和注释来提高脚本的可维护性。教学资源-软硬件资源:计算机教室、笔记本电脑、粤教版B版五年级上册信息技术教材、教师操作台

-课程平台:学校网络教学平台

-信息化资源:角色脚本编程软件(如Scratch等)、相关教学视频、在线编程社区

-教学手段:多媒体教学课件、实物教具(如编程机器人)、学生练习手册教学过程设计一、导入环节(5分钟)

1.创设情境:通过播放一段动画或视频,展示角色在游戏或故事中的互动,引导学生思考角色是如何通过脚本实现动作的。

2.提出问题:引导学生思考脚本在信息技术中的应用,例如:“你们知道在哪些软件中可以编写脚本?脚本的作用是什么?”

3.小组讨论:学生分组讨论,分享自己对脚本的初步认识。

二、讲授新课(15分钟)

1.脚本基本概念:讲解脚本的定义、组成和功能,以Scratch软件为例,展示脚本的编辑界面。

2.角色动作编程:以角色移动为例,讲解如何通过编写脚本控制角色的行为,如前进、后退、转向等。

3.逻辑判断的应用:讲解在脚本中如何实现条件判断,如“如果...则...”结构,并通过实例展示。

三、巩固练习(20分钟)

1.学生独立练习:学生根据所学知识,编写简单的角色脚本,如控制角色移动到特定位置。

2.小组合作:学生分组,共同完成一个较为复杂的角色脚本,如实现角色与障碍物的互动。

3.展示与评价:每组展示自己的作品,其他组进行评价,教师给予反馈。

四、课堂提问(5分钟)

1.针对重点内容进行提问,如:“如何通过脚本实现角色与障碍物的碰撞检测?”

2.鼓励学生提出问题,如:“脚本在编程中的应用还有哪些?”

3.学生回答问题,教师进行点评和总结。

五、师生互动环节(10分钟)

1.教师与学生互动:教师针对学生的疑问进行解答,引导学生深入理解脚本编程的概念。

2.学生互动:学生之间相互讨论,共同解决问题。

3.教师提问:教师提出具有挑战性的问题,激发学生的创新思维。

六、创新教学

1.创设情境:通过实际案例,让学生了解脚本编程在现实生活中的应用,如智能家居、虚拟现实等。

2.游戏化教学:将角色脚本编程融入游戏,提高学生的学习兴趣。

3.多媒体教学:运用多媒体技术,展示脚本编程的动态效果,增强学生的直观感受。

七、核心素养拓展

1.培养学生的创新思维:鼓励学生在编程过程中尝试不同的脚本组合,提高问题解决能力。

2.增强学生的合作意识:通过小组合作完成脚本编程任务,培养学生的团队协作能力。

3.提高学生的动手实践能力:让学生动手编写脚本,提高实际操作能力。

教学过程流程环节:

1.导入环节(5分钟)

2.讲授新课(15分钟)

3.巩固练习(20分钟)

4.课堂提问(5分钟)

5.师生互动环节(10分钟)

6.创新教学(5分钟)

7.核心素养拓展(5分钟)

总用时:45分钟学生学习效果学生学习效果主要体现在以下几个方面:

1.知识掌握

-学生能够理解脚本的基本概念,包括动作、事件和逻辑判断等。

-学生能够通过Scratch软件或其他编程工具编写简单的角色脚本,实现角色的基本动作控制。

-学生能够理解并应用条件判断,使角色在特定条件下执行不同的动作。

2.技能提升

-学生提高了计算机操作技能,尤其是对编程软件的使用能力。

-学生培养了逻辑思维和问题解决能力,能够通过编程解决简单的实际问题。

-学生学会了团队合作,能够在小组合作中有效沟通和协作,共同完成编程任务。

3.创新能力

-学生通过编程实践,激发了创新思维,能够提出新的编程想法和解决方案。

-学生在编写脚本的过程中,尝试不同的编程技巧和创意,提升了创新能力。

4.信息意识

-学生认识到信息技术在现实生活中的广泛应用,提高了信息意识。

-学生能够认识到编程是信息技术的重要组成部分,对信息技术的发展有了更深的理解。

5.实践能力

-学生通过实际操作,将理论知识转化为实践能力,提高了动手实践能力。

-学生能够在实践中发现问题、解决问题,提高了实际操作技能。

6.自主学习

-学生学会了自主学习,能够在遇到问题时,通过查阅资料、讨论等方式解决问题。

-学生能够独立完成编程任务,提高了自主学习的能力。

7.社交能力

-学生在小组合作中,学会了与他人沟通和协作,提高了社交能力。

-学生能够尊重他人的意见,学会倾听和表达,提升了团队协作能力。教学反思教学反思

这节课下来,我深感信息技术教育的重要性,同时也对自己的教学过程进行了深入的思考。以下是我的一些教学反思:

首先,我发现学生在搭建角色脚本的过程中,对脚本的概念和逻辑判断的理解比较困难。这让我意识到,在教学过程中,我应该更加注重概念的解释和逻辑思维的培养。例如,我可以在讲解脚本时,结合具体的实例,让学生直观地看到脚本是如何影响角色的行为的。同时,通过一些互动练习,让学生在实践中逐步理解逻辑判断的运用。

其次,我在课堂上观察到,学生的合作意识较强,但在具体操作时,部分学生表现出一定的依赖心理。为了培养学生的独立思考和解决问题的能力,我尝试在小组合作中设置一些难度较大的任务,鼓励学生独立思考和尝试。通过这样的方式,我发现学生的自主性得到了提升,他们在面对问题时能够更加自信地提出解决方案。

再者,我在教学过程中发现,学生的创新思维和编程能力有待提高。为了激发学生的创新意识,我尝试引入了一些有趣的编程挑战,如设计一个能够完成特定任务的脚本。这样的活动不仅提高了学生的编程兴趣,还激发了他们的创新思维。在接下来的教学中,我将继续探索如何更好地培养学生的创新能力和编程技巧。

此外,我也反思了自己在教学过程中的不足。例如,在讲解新知识时,我发现自己的讲解速度较快,部分学生可能跟不上进度。为了解决这个问题,我计划在今后的教学中,适当放慢讲解速度,确保每个学生都能跟上教学的节奏。

在教学手段上,我也进行了反思。虽然多媒体教学课件和教学视频在课堂上起到了很好的辅助作用,但过多的依赖可能会让学生忽视实际操作的重要性。因此,我决定在今后的教学中,更加注重学生的动手实践,让学生在操作中学习,在实践中提高。

最后,我认为教学评价也是教学过程中不可忽视的一环。在今后的教学中,我将更加注重学生的个体差异,根据学生的学习情况给予针对性的评价,同时鼓励学生自我评价,提高他们的自我认知能力。典型例题讲解例题1:编写一个脚本,使角色在按下空格键后向右移动10步。

解答:

```

当角色按下空格键时

移动角色向右10步

```

例题2:编写一个脚本,使角色在移动到特定位置时停止移动。

解答:

```

当角色到达特定位置时

停止移动角色

```

例题3:编写一个脚本,使角色在检测到障碍物时改变方向。

解答:

```

当角色与障碍物碰撞时

改变角色方向为向左

```

例题4:编写一个脚本,使角色在连续按下空格键时加速移动。

解答:

```

当角色按下空格键时

移动角色向右,速度+1

当角色按下空格键时

移动角色向右,速度+1

```

例题5:编写一个脚本,使角色在移动过程中收集金币,并显示收集到的金币数量。

解答:

```

当角色与金币碰撞时

收集金币

金币数量+1

更新金币数量显示

```

这些例题涵盖了角色脚本编程中的基本概念和操作,如移动、碰撞检测、条件判断等。通过这些例题,学生可以巩固对脚本编程的理解,并学会在实际情境中应用所学知识。作业布置与反馈作业布置:

1.完成以下角色脚本编程任务,并保存为“角色脚本作业1”:

-编写一个脚本,使角色在屏幕上随机移动,并在移动过程中收集散落在屏幕上的星星。

-每收集到一个星星,角色的分数增加10分。

-当角色收集到一定数量的星星后,显示“恭喜你,完成了任务!”的提示。

2.小组合作完成以下角色脚本编程任务,并保存为“角色脚本作业2”:

-设计一个简单的游戏场景,角色需要躲避从屏幕上方掉落的障碍物。

-角色可以通过左右移动来躲避障碍物。

-每当角色成功躲避一个障碍物,角色的生命值增加。

-如果角色被障碍物碰到,游戏结束,显示“游戏失败”的提示。

作业反馈:

1.对学生的作业进行批改,检查以下方面:

-脚本是否正确实现了任务要求。

-脚本的结构是否清晰,逻辑是否合理。

-是否使用了适当的编程技巧,如循环、条件判断等。

2.及时给予反馈:

-对于完成任务的作业,给予正面评价,并指出亮点和改进空间。

-对于未完成或完成不理想的作业,分析原因,提出具体改进建议。

-对于特别优秀的作业,可以给

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论